malta: Clean allocation of bios region alias
It is sufficient to define the region alias once for all code branches.
Signed-off-by: Stefan Weil <sw@weilnetz.de>
malta: Always allocate flash memory
There is no reason why there should not be a flash memory when theMalta emulation is started with a Linux kernel. When flash memoryis always available, the code is simpler, and it can be better tested.
malta: Use symbolic hardware addresses
The patch adds definitions of some hardware addresses and uses thesedefinitions.
It also replaces the type of all addresses from signed to unsigned values.This is only a cosmetic change because addresses are unsigned values,...
malta: Fix display for LED array
The 8-LED array was already implemented in the first commit to Malta,but this implementation was incomplete.
mips hw/: Don't use CPUState
Scripted conversion: for file in hw/mips_*.[hc]; do sed -i "s/CPUState/CPUMIPSState/g" $file done
Signed-off-by: Andreas Färber <afaerber@suse.de>Acked-by: Anthony Liguori <aliguori@us.ibm.com>
ppc hw/: Don't use CPUState
Scripted conversion: for file in hw/ppc*.[hc] hw/mpc8544_guts.c hw/spapr*.[hc] hw/virtex_ml507.c hw/xics.c; do sed -i "s/CPUState/CPUPPCState/g" $file done
s390x hw/: Don't use CPUState
Scripted conversion: for file in hw/s390-*.[hc]; do sed -i "s/CPUState/CPUS390XState/g" $file done
sh4 hw/: Don't use CPUState
Scripted conversion: for file in hw/sh.h hw/shix.c hw/r2d.c; do sed -i "s/CPUState/CPUSH4State/g" $file done
sparc hw/: Don't use CPUState
Scripted conversion: for file in hw/sun4m.c hw/sun4u.c hw/grlib.h hw/leon3.c; do sed -i "s/CPUState/CPUSPARCState/g" $file done
xtensa hw/: Don't use CPUState
Scripted conversion: for file in hw/xtensa_*.[hc]; do sed -i "s/CPUState/CPUXtensaState/g" $file done
View revisions
Also available in: Atom